全部产品
Search
文档中心

:Fitur

更新时间:Jun 21, 2025

Topik ini menjelaskan cara menggunakan SDK Push untuk Android serta kelas dan metode yang terdapat dalam SDK. Topik ini juga memberikan contoh penggunaan fitur yang disediakan oleh SDK Push untuk Android. Dengan membaca topik ini, Anda dapat lebih memahami cara menggunakan SDK untuk aliran langsung.

Antarmuka umum

Kelas

Deskripsi

AlivcLivePushConfig

Kelas untuk pengaturan ingest aliran.

AlivcLivePusher

Kelas untuk fitur ingest aliran.

AlivcLivePusherErrorListener

Kelas untuk callback kesalahan.

AlivcLivePusherNetworkListener

Kelas untuk callback jaringan.

AlivcLivePusherInfoListener

Kelas untuk callback ingest aliran.

AlivcLivePusherBGMListener

Kelas untuk callback musik latar.

AlivcLivePushCustomFilter

Kelas untuk callback filter kustom.

AlivcLivePushCustomDetect

Kelas untuk callback deteksi wajah kustom.

AlivcSnapshotListener

Kelas untuk callback snapshot.

Co-streaming (edisi interaktif)

SDK Push untuk Android Edisi Interaktif V4.4.4 dan yang lebih baru menyediakan kemampuan co-streaming berbasis RTC. Mulai versi V4.4.5, SDK Push untuk Android Edisi Interaktif juga mendukung pertarungan co-streaming berbasis RTC. Anda dapat menggunakan SDK Push untuk Android Edisi Interaktif guna mengimplementasikan interaksi ultra-rendah-latensi (kurang dari 300 ms) antara streamer dan penonton co-streaming. Untuk informasi lebih lanjut tentang cara menggunakan fitur co-streaming, lihat Panduan Pengembangan Co-streaming dan Panduan Pengembangan Pertarungan Streamer.

null

Co-streaming tidak mendukung ingest aliran rekaman layar.

Pertimbangan

Perhatikan item yang dijelaskan dalam tabel berikut sebelum menggunakan SDK Push untuk Android:

Item

Deskripsi

Aturan obfuscation

Periksa konfigurasi obfuscation. Pastikan nama paket SDK Push untuk Android dihapus dari daftar obfuscation.

-keep class com.alivc.** { *;}

Pemanggilan metode

  • Anda dapat memanggil metode sinkron dan asinkron. Namun, kami sarankan agar Anda mencoba untuk tidak memanggil metode sinkron karena metode ini mengonsumsi sumber daya utas utama.

  • SDK Push untuk Android melemparkan pengecualian ketika Anda gagal memanggil metode yang diperlukan atau memanggil metode dalam urutan yang tidak valid. Anda harus menambahkan pernyataan try-catch untuk mencegah keluar tak terduga.

  • Gambar berikut menunjukkan cara memanggil metode dalam urutan yang benar: